Loose Tooth

by Sugarray77

With the string tied tight
and a loud slam of the door
he lost his first tooth

An old story tells of a small boy who was afraid to lose his tooth. He would not let anyone touch it until Grandpa told him he wanted to tie a string around it for safekeeping. The boy allowed him to tie the string and then Grandpa tied the other end to a door handle and slammed the door. Out came the tooth to his surprise. So the story goes.....
